Sterling Engineering is looking for a Lead Hardware Engineer with a leading manufacturer of  automotive battery and electrical system test equipment platforms Near Burr Ridge, IL. The Lead Hardware Engineer job responsibilities include all aspects of hardware design and development to ensure performance, reliability, and an overall high-quality product. In this role, the Lead Hardware Engineer will be working and, in some cases, lead design teams.

Job Duties:
  • Electronics hardware design and development delivering high-quality, reliable, on-time products that meet customer needs
  • Create and maintain product technical documentation – specifications, design documents
  • Design and troubleshoot microcontrollers and embedded mixed-signal systems at the component level
  • Perform schematic capture, work with layout resources, and perform board bring-up and development validation on designs
  • Initiate and participate in hardware/platform design reviews
  • Collaborate with mechanical, software, and production teams to support design tasks and projects
  • Partner with customers and technical teams to develop designs and solutions addressing specific needs/problems
  • Intake tasks, create WBS, estimate effort, and perform to estimations
  • Drive continual improvements in hardware engineering processes
  • Maintain and use hardware engineering standards
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Electrical Engineering or equivalent – MBA a plus
  • 7–10+ years’ experience in product design for commercial and/or industrial devices
  • Strong expertise in complex mixed signal, digital, and analog design – development, testing, and debugging
  • Ability to provide technical assessment and leadership to other project team members and departments
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Experience with UL, CB Scheme, etc. a plus
